Regarding the buttons, the Gamesir X5 Lite includes a regular D-pad alongside ABXY buttons and two Hall effect sensor analog sticks. It also comes equipped with dual shoulder and trigger buttons. Nonetheless, I found myself hoping that Gamesir would have chosen analog triggers for better precision during certain gameplays instead of the present button-style triggers. One aspect I was thankful to see was Gamesir allowing for multi OS support, meaning I could pair it with both my iOS and Android devices. Additionally, I was astonished seeing just how wide of a device I was able to use with it, even allowing me to use my 6th Gen iPad Mini, something I would not have been able to do with my previous Razer unit.

Switching between OS compatibility with the Gamesir X5 Lite is as simple as holding two buttons for a few seconds, and I could easily toggle between whichever type of device I wanted to use. Gone are the days of needing a separate device for each os, something that can be pretty pricey depending on where you buy your controller from.

The button actions on the Gamesir X5 Lite are smooth and offer a gentle touch, a preference of mine compared to more clicking buttons. Additionally, this feature helps minimize disturbance for people around when playing in silent settings where sound could be problematic.

If your phone’s battery begins to drain, there’s no reason to fret—Gamesir tackles this issue using a pass-through USB-C port that lets you recharge as you game. This capability becomes particularly handy during flights, train rides, or long car journeys where kids might be engrossed in mobile games. Moreover, the inclusion of variously sized bumper spacers in the package means gamers with bulky protective cases won’t have to take off their cases just to enjoy playing with the X5 Lite.
